How do people over 18 use the Internet in small towns?
No matter the size of a population, if it has Internet, its use is frequent and with devices that require a good connection. This is demonstrated by the most recent data from the ASTEO Observatory study among different age segments in populations in areas of Spain with less than 10,000 and 1,000 inhabitants that have a fixed or mobile connection.

Young people between 18 and 34 years old are the group, with respect to the rest of the age groups, that most use Smart TV (75%), Tablet/iPad (70%) and Consoles (43%). And, although the percentage is anecdotal, home automation equipment or remote connection (14%). In addition, together with the 35-44 group, they are the least likely to use a desktop PC.

And what do they do when they connect to these devices?
They are the segment that uses social networks, blogs and messaging the most (89%), those who watch movies, series or sports the most (74%) and those who make the most online purchases (64%). On the other hand, they are the ones who use it the least, compared to other age groups, to surf or send e-mails, although their percentage is still very high at 81% and 89% respectively.
